Describe the functions of the main regions of the digestive system, limited to: (a) mouth – ingestion, physical digestion, chemical digestion of starch by amylase (b) salivary glands – secretion of saliva containing amylase (c) stomach – physical digestion, chemical digestion of protein by protease, presence of hydrochloric acid in gastric secretions (d) small intestine (duodenum and ileum) – chemical digestion of starch by amylase, maltose by maltase, protein by protease and lipids by lipase (e) liver – production of bile and storage of glycogen (f) gall bladder – storage of bile (g) pancreas – alkaline secretion containing amylase, protease and lipase (h) ileum and colon – absorption (i) rectum and anus – egestion
